You will receive hands-on instruction from professional cyclocross rider: Mark McConnell of Hot Sauce Cycling. This is an introduction to cyclocross clinic open to riders of all ability levels. We will spend time reviewing bike set up, mounts, dismounts, starts, cornering, running with and shouldering the bike, barrier practice, and to finish - a mini race to put all of the skills together (with some saucy podium prizes).

About the instructor:

Mark McConnell aka Hot Sauce Cycling has been racing professional cyclocross for the past five years. He has spent several seasons abroad racing against the best in the World in his pursuit of cyclocross excellence. Mark is a three time member of the Canadian National Team at the past three CX World Championships, and believes that cyclocross is a year round sport - if you practice now, it will be far more fun (and less painful) when the season begins!
